Oct 16, 2022 · When comparing a bottle jack to a floor jack, another significant difference is their lift range. A bottle jack typically has a lift range of 5 to 22 inches. This lift range suits smaller vehicles or those with high ground clearance, like an RV. On the other hand, a floor jack usually has a lift range of about 21 inches.

The bottle jack has a broader base area compared to the scissors jack. The wider the base, the more stable the jack will hold to the ground or the supporting plate. The broad base of the bottle jack is convenient for lifting weights at inclined angles. Feb 20, 2024 · Price. Bottle jacks are much cheaper than a floor jack. Floor jacks tend to be at least $100 for the lowest end model, while almost all bottle jacks are cheaper than $100. If you’re on a budget, this may be something to consider while shopping. For those who don’t want to spend too much money, you’re better off purchasing a bottle jack. Most manual jacks are what you might call “hand pump.” Using the handle, you pump the hydraulic shaft full of air, and it pushes out the rod assembly, raising the jack. Most domestic floor or bottle jacks require more pumps to get the car into the air. Here are a few key points: Weight: The average car and SUV tips the scale somewhere between 2,000 and 2,500 kg (4,400 and 5,500 lb.). For most simple jobs, a 2-ton jack will work; however, investing in one with more capability is never a bad idea. For most offroaders a Hi-Lift jack is little more than a fashion statement. Get a 6 ton bottle jack and carry a 12x12 piece of 3/4" plywood for a base. A couple of pieces of 2x4 can be used as spacers if you need more height. As the jack lifts the car the center of mass changes, and can cause the jack to tilt. This is especially true for bottle jacks. Regular jacks create force normally by the swinging of the handles, but the low-profile jacks have to use ...It would be terrific if you removed the bottle jack’s fill plug and examined its oil chamber. The recommended level for the bottle jack is approximately 3/16 to a quarter over the tank. If you have to refill, ensure you have the best quality oil. If your bottle jack oil level exceeds the proposed level, you will need to drain it up.
